Responsibilities and Daily Tasks

On a day-to-day basis, you’ll keep shelves stocked, organized, and presentable, ensuring grocery items are fresh and displayed attractively. Accurate product receiving is a major task, from checking deliveries against invoices to documenting inventory and noting damaged goods or shortages. You’ll also assist customers, answer questions, and ring up purchases efficiently at the register when needed. Safe food handling and cleanliness are always in focus for all workspaces and storage areas. Periodic inventory counts, department cross-communication, and supporting team goals round out your shift.

Potential Drawbacks

This isn’t a sedentary position; you’ll be on your feet for much of the shift, with some lifting periodically required. The physical environment can be demanding—expect cooler, warmer, or more humid areas such as freezers or storage rooms. The job includes handling products (sometimes heavy or bulky), stocking shelves, and managing deliveries, which may not appeal to everyone.

The role may also require flexible availability, including weekends or holidays, based on the store’s needs. Occasionally, you could encounter challenging customers, requiring a calm and positive attitude to resolve issues efficiently.
